LIPSCOMB UNIT

LIPSCOMB UNIT is a Texas oil lease in Brazos County, Railroad Commission district 03, operated by Dee-Jay Exploration Company.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from March 2003 to August 2026, totalling 4,993 barrels. The lease is not currently producing. Its strongest month on the record we hold was May 2016, at 71 barrels.
